Japanese Boat to Be Released

The Foreign Ministry said that Russia would return a Japanese fishing boat seized off the Pacific Coast last month, but there was no word on whether the crew of 17 would also be released.
Hoshin Maru 88
The ministry said it informed Japan that the Hoshin Maru 88, captured by the Coast Guard on June 3 and taken to a port on the Kamchatka Peninsula, would be returned in exchange for a fine that has not yet been determined. Japan's Foreign Ministry said Friday that it had filed a complaint with an international maritime court.
